Arkansas athletics ends partnership with Blueprint Sports, parent company of Arkansas Edge NIL collective

FAYETTEVILLE — The Arkansas Razorbacks are ending their relationship with Blueprint Sports, the parent company of the Arkansas Edge NIL collective, Arkansas’ athletics department announced in a press release Monday.

The partnership with Blueprint Sports began in November 2023 and will officially end Oct. 15. According to the news release, the athletics department on July 1 assumed all NIL agreements with athletes that were previously executed by Blueprint Sports.

Arkansas athletics director Hunter Yurachek said last week those agreements have totaled more than $500,000, or about $15,000 per agreement.

According to the news release, “the two parties [the Razorbacks and Blueprint Sports] have explored future opportunities to work together, but a clear solution never developed.
